Creative Masked Lapwing

The Masked Lapwing is incredibly creative. It has adapted to building simple ground nests in unexpected places such as school ovals, roundabouts, car parks, and urban parks.

Green Adelaide

Green Adelaide is a South Australian Government supported organisation that is working towards a vision of a cooler, greener, wilder and climate-resilient metropolitan South Australia. The Green Adelaide area spans from the hills to the sea, encompassing 17 metropolitan council areas and about 1.3 million South Australians.
